Optimization of equipment life cycle cost

Abstract equipment life cycle cost refers to the cost incurred in the whole process of equipment planning, manufacturing, installation and commissioning, use, maintenance, transformation and scrapping, including original cost and usage cost. In order to achieve the goal of optimizing the life cycle cost of equipment, several aspects must be done: (1) ensure the optimization of life cycle cost in the whole process of equipment; (2) Implement comprehensive management of equipment from the aspects of technology, economy and organization; (3) Focus on the reliability and maintainability design of equipment; (4) Implement the whole process management of the equipment; (5) Pay attention to the information feedback in the process of equipment working cycle

With the continuous development of science and technology, high-precision, high-efficiency and high automation equipment is gradually increasing, and the investment cost of equipment is becoming more and more expensive. The proportion of equipment related costs in the product cost is also increasing. Therefore, strengthening equipment management and reducing the life cycle cost of equipment play a very important role in improving the economic benefits of enterprises. The main goal of traditional equipment management is to maintain the normal production capacity of equipment and prolong the service life of equipment. Most of its work is the technical management of equipment. Modern equipment management emphasizes obtaining higher comprehensive efficiency and reducing the life cycle cost of equipment. The goal of pursuing is economic benefits. 1. Ensure the optimization of life cycle cost in the whole process of equipment

the life cycle of equipment refers to the whole process of equipment from planning, manufacturing, installation and commissioning, use, maintenance, transformation to scrapping. The life cycle cost of equipment refers to the total cost consumed in the whole process of equipment, which is composed of original cost and usage cost. The original fee (setup fee) is a one-time expenditure or concentrated expenditure in a short period of time. Self made equipment includes research, design and manufacturing costs; The purchased equipment includes the price, transportation, installation and commissioning costs. The usage fee (operation and maintenance fee) is the fee paid regularly to ensure the normal operation of the equipment, including energy fee, fixed asset tax, insurance premium, maintenance fee, operator's salary, etc. Therefore, when making equipment operation decisions, we should not only consider the economy of a certain stage of the equipment life cycle (manufacturing, procurement, use and maintenance), but also pay great attention to the most economical sum of the original cost and usage cost of the equipment. For example, when designing a new equipment, we should not only consider reducing the manufacturing cost, but also consider the economic and reasonable use cost; When choosing new equipment, we should not covet cheap prices, but also take into account a series of other costs after the purchase of the equipment. In fact, the cheapest purchase price does not necessarily mean the lowest life cycle cost, and the best life cycle cost does not mean the lowest life cycle cost. Factors such as the production efficiency of the equipment and the assurance degree of output and quality should also be considered. In practical work, economy and technology are dialectically unified. Because economic benefits are the direct driving force to promote the development of production tools, only new machines and equipment with advanced technology and reasonable economy can be widely used. Therefore, the planning, purchase, use, renewal, transformation and other links of equipment management must be analyzed for economic benefits according to the principles of advanced technology and reasonable economy, as a basis for evaluating many schemes The main basis for selection and decision-making, which is also an important way to improve economic benefits

2. Comprehensive management of equipment from the aspects of technology, economy and organization

comprehensive management of equipment by integrating the factors of technology, economy and organization is the objective need to manage, use, repair and operate modern equipment well. With the continuous improvement of the modernization level of equipment, there are more and more categories of equipment and devices that embody science and technology. Not only do various specialized technologies develop in depth, but also all kinds of specialized technologies are required to be integrated horizontally. Therefore, in terms of technology, we must master a variety of science and technology to become one expert and versatile; In terms of economy, pay attention to improving the economic effect of equipment management, and analyze the economic problems existing in each link of equipment management, including the economic analysis of equipment selection, the economic standard of reasonable use, the economic problem of inspection times, the economic limit of repair, etc; In terms of organization and management, it involves the relationship between people. We must study the organizational personnel and management system, and formulate a set of management methods such as industrial operation, overall planning, quality control and value analysis

3. Focus on the reliability and maintainability design of equipment

reliability means that the equipment is accurate, safe, reliable and trouble free in operation. Maintainability refers to easy maintenance, including simple structure and reasonable combination of parts and components; The repair channel is good, which can be quickly disassembled and easy to check; High level of generalization and standardization, strong interchangeability, etc. its purpose is to improve the availability of equipment. The ideal limit of the reliability and maintainability of the equipment is the design without maintenance, and it will be scrapped after a certain period of use. At present, some equipment has reached the ideal limit of no maintenance. Through the development of maintenance free design technology, the structure of the equipment can be simplified under the condition of ensuring high performance, high efficiency and high precision. Therefore, the general trend of equipment development is a dialectical development process of simplicity, complexity and simplicity

5. Pay attention to the information feedback in the process of equipment working cycle

in equipment management, the equipment user department timely and accurately feed back the situation in the process of equipment use to the equipment manufacturing department, so as to improve the equipment design and continuously improve the performance and quality of the equipment

there are two kinds of information feedback in the process of equipment working cycle. One is off-site feedback, which refers to the feedback from the user department to the manufacturing department.
